Melbourne Serviced Apartments offers a Tuscan-style Fitzroy St apartment which is just one of their many apartments located in the CBD, East Melbourne, Carlton, Brunswick, Port Melbourne, St. Kilda and Southbank.

Like all of their apartments, Tuscany is close to restaurants, bars, cafes, and everyday shops, with air-conditioning, free internet, local calls and security parking. Each apartment has a full kitchen, bathroom, laundry facilities and air-conditioning, and extra beds or a cot if needed. All have LCD TVs, DVD players, games and more.

Tuscany is a one-bedroom apt with double sofa bed and single foldaway, but we also have two-bedroom apartments in various locations; all within 5kms of the CBD.

Tuscany, in St Kilda

This is a beautiful apartment in a great, quiet location, only 15 minutes by from the CBD. The trams are just across the road. Starting within 50 metres, you can access huge parks, restaurants, cafes, shops and supermarkets, bars and ATMS; everyday needs are well catered for. All of their apartments have beautiful designer-interior, with king and queen beds. Many have a double sofa bed and a foldaway bed for extra people if needed. All bedrooms have block-out blinds. Parking, local calls, internet, LCD TV, DVD player and hi-fi, air-conditioning, modern kitchen, laundry facilities, shower, linen, crockery, glassware are included. CBD parking is extra. Everyday items are supplied, and the beds are really comfy.13
